There’s an excellent book by Angela Duckworth titled Grit. Dr. Duckworth defines Grit as: Grit is a positive psychological trait defined as the combination of passion and perseverance towards long term goals. I believe that these two factors create a mindset that helps us keep on a more positive trajectory! Her research has shown that when young people have this combination they much more likely to succeed than those who lack these traits.
